Reading Revenue by Crew and by Day
The two most useful cuts of data for a soft washing company are revenue by crew and revenue by day. Knowing which crew produces the most completed work, and at what value, tells you where your training and your best routes should go. Knowing which days of the week earn the most helps you staff and schedule to match real demand instead of a flat assumption. Tracking Estimates, Wins, and Pricing
Revenue is only half the story; the other half is how well you convert estimates into paid work. IndustryBossPro keeps every estimate attached to its customer and job, so you can see how many quotes turned into booked washes and how your pricing held up over time. For a soft washing business, tracking your win rate reveals whether you are priced right for your market or leaving money on the table. If most quotes convert instantly, you may be too cheap; if few do, your pricing or your follow-up needs work. Because estimates and invoices share the same data, you can also compare what you quoted to what you actually billed, catching the scope creep that erodes margins one add-on at a time. Keeping this history in one place means you can look back at what similar properties paid last season and keep your pricing consistent rather than reinventing a number on every call. Over time, this record becomes a pricing playbook built from your own real results, not a competitor's guess. That is far more valuable than any generic rate chart, because it reflects exactly what your customers in your area will actually pay.
Seeing the Value of Recurring Revenue
Recurring revenue is the most valuable number a soft washing company can grow, and it deserves its own line of sight. IndustryBossPro's recurring routes and card-on-file auto-billing mean a portion of your revenue arrives predictably each cycle, and seeing that figure clearly changes how you run the business. When you know how much money is locked into maintenance accounts, you can forecast slow seasons, plan hires, and decide how aggressively to chase new one-off work. A company living entirely on one-time jobs starts every month at zero, while one with a solid recurring base starts with a floor under it. Tracking the size and growth of that recurring book tells you whether your account-management efforts are actually paying off.
